Pavel Kuznetsov

Pavel Kuznetsov (Russian: Павел Варфоломеевич Кузнецов) was a Russian artist, celebrated for his pioneering role in the Symbolist movement and his profound influence on the development of Russian modernist art. Born into the late 19th century, Kuznetsov's work spans painting, sculpture, and illustration, showcasing a unique blend of Eastern and Western artistic traditions.

Kuznetsov's art is renowned for its vibrant use of color, ethereal landscapes, and mystical themes. His distinctive style combines traditional Russian iconography with the innovative techniques of European modernism, making his work highly prized among collectors and art enthusiasts. Kuznetsov was a key member of the Blue Rose artist group, which sought to express the spiritual and emotional through art. This collective's contributions are considered seminal in the evolution of Russian Symbolism.

Among Kuznetsov's notable works are his dreamlike paintings of Central Asia, which brought a new dimension to Russian art by introducing themes and aesthetics from Eastern cultures. These pieces are not only significant for their artistic merit but also for how they reflect the cross-cultural exchanges of the early 20th century. Some of his masterpieces are held in prestigious institutions, including the Tretyakov Gallery and the Russian Museum, making them accessible to the public and subject to scholarly study.

For collectors and experts in the fields of art and antiques, Kuznetsov's works represent a valuable intersection of cultural heritage and artistic innovation. His contributions to the Symbolist movement and Russian modernism continue to inspire and influence contemporary art discourse.

Date and place of birt:17 november 1878, Saratov, Russian Empire
Date and place of death:21 february 1968, Moscow, USSR
Nationality:Russia
Period of activity: XIX, XX century
Specialization:Artist, Decorator, Educator, Graphic artist, Painter
Art school / group:Mir iskusstva, Moscow Association of Artists, Salon d'Automne, Union of Russian Artists (1903-1923)
Genre:Genre art, Landscape painting, Portrait, Still life
Art style:Modern art, Orientalism
